Can I get into Rice with a 3.3 GPA?

What GPA do you need to get into Rice University? Applicants require exceptionally good grades to get into Rice. The average high school GPA of the admitted freshman class at Rice University was 3.96 on the 4.0 scale indicating that primarily A- students are accepted and ultimately attend.

Can I get into Rice with a 31 ACT?

Admissions Overview Rice admissions is extremely selective with an acceptance rate of 9\%. Students that get into Rice have an average SAT score between 1470-1570 or an average ACT score of 33-35. The regular admissions application deadline for Rice is January 1.

Can I get into Rice with a 1400 SAT?

The 25th percentile New SAT score is 1450, and the 75th percentile SAT score is 1560. In other words, a 1450 places you below average, while a 1560 will move you up to above average. There’s no absolute SAT requirement at Rice University, but they really want to see at least a 1450 to have a chance at being considered.

What is the average GPA for Rice University?

Top colleges want well-prepared students, and the average GPA of incoming students at Rice is 3.96 unweighted, with an average SAT of 1510, and average ACT of 34. If your grades and scores are below these averages, you’ll have to have some other part of your application which is stronger than average.

What is the minimum SAT score required for Rice University?

Rice University typically requires applicants to be in the top 2 percent of SAT test takers. The school consistently takes SAT composite scores down to 1460 on a 1600 scale, below which admission should be considered a reach.
